The Milford Historical Society, 1988-01-01. Hardcover. Fine/Very Good+. Large Hardcover, Stated Revised Edition 1988 The Milford Historical Society 308 pages. Fine, in a VG+ DJ. Blue cloth boards with silver spine titles - corners sharp. The book looks brand new because the DJ did its job in protecting it. Minor shelf/edge wear and rubbing to original DJ - now in mylar. Platt map endpapers. No previous owner markings - all pages are clean and unmarked. 24 chapters on the history of Milford, Michigan. Excellent local history with many family names, businesses, churches and more. Lots of vintage photographs and a few maps. A superb copy in a VG+ DJ. ISBN-0960774211. LOC SSS-TS-03
